Modular combat helmets are versatile headgear designed primarily for military, law enforcement, and tactical use. They feature a modular design that allows users to customize and adapt the helmet with various attachments such as visors, communication systems, night vision devices, and protective shields. These helmets offer a balance between protection, comfort, and adaptability, making them suitable for diverse operational environments.
Key Features
- Interchangeable components for customization
- Robust ballistic protection materials (often Kevlar or composite fibers)
- Compatibility with mounting accessories (visors, cameras, lights)
- Enhanced comfort with adjustable padding and suspension systems
- Integrated communication systems for coordination
- Lightweight yet durable construction
Pros
- High level of customization allows tailored solutions for different missions
- Provides good ballistic and impact protection
- Facilitates communication and situational awareness through integrated systems
- Modular design enables easy upgrades and repairs
- Suitable for a variety of tactical scenarios
Cons
- Can be more expensive than traditional helmets due to added features
- Potentially heavier depending on configuration and accessories
- Complexity may require training for effective use
- Regular maintenance needed to ensure all components function properly
